What determines the frequency of water sampling?

The frequency of water sampling is primarily determined by the population served. This is because larger populations typically require more frequent monitoring to ensure safe drinking water. The rationale behind this is that a larger population increases the demand for water and, correspondingly, the complexities involved in maintaining water quality. Efficiently managing the water supply, detecting contaminants, and ensuring compliance with health regulations necessitates a systematic sampling approach that aligns with the population size.

In addition, more extensive populations often lead to diverse sources and systems within the water distribution network, which can introduce various risks for contamination. Therefore, an increase in the population served typically correlates with stricter health guidelines and regulations that dictate more frequent testing schedules.

While other factors, such as the size of the treatment plant, the type of water source, and seasonal changes, may influence water quality and safety, they are secondary to the primary factor of population size when determining sampling frequency.
